Hi Franklin,

I bought my SODIMM locally here, on the AU Gold Coast from 
cheapmemory.com.au [who will ship anywhere!]. They won't sell you memory 
that is incompatible with your system - just advise them of the details 
of your thinkpad. I was advised that I could *only* use the low-density 
modules in my Sony VAIO PCG-F190.  they also have 256MB low-density 
SODIMMS, I will be trying those out later, after I completely finish 
configuring the system, which currently has original W98 [from small 
HDD] plus eCS 1.1 and 2 * eCS 1.2, W2K Pro next to go on, to see whether 
I can exceed the nominal 192MB maximum that was quoted in 1999!
